ComEd’s new fleet electrification plan calls for replacing all of its light duty vehicles with electrified vehicles (EVs and PHEVs) by 2030. ComEd will replace end-of-life internal combustion vehicles with plug-in hybrid and fully electric vehicles, reducing fuel and maintenance costs and creating savings that will be passed on to customers.

Battery electric cars emit less greenhouse gases and air pollutants over their entire life cycle than petrol and diesel cars, according to a European Environment Agency (EEA) report. Emissions are usually higher in the production phase of electric cars, but these are more than offset by lower emissions in the use phase over time.
